| // RandomnessSource provides random bits to Generators.
 | |
| //
 | |
| // If it's live, a PRNG will be used and the random values will be recorded into
 | |
| // its RandomRun.
 | |
| //
 | |
| // If it's recorded, its RandomRun will be used to "mock" the PRNG. This allows
 | |
| // us to replay the generation of a particular value, and to test out
 | |
| // "alternative histories": "what if the PRNG generated 0 instead of 13 here?"
 | |
| class RandomnessSource {
 | |
| public:
 | |
|     static RandomnessSource live() { return RandomnessSource(RandomRun(), true); }
 | |
|     static RandomnessSource recorded(RandomRun const& run) { return RandomnessSource(run, false); }
 | |
|     RandomRun& run() { return m_run; }
 | |
|     u64 draw_value(u64 max, Function<u64()> random_generator)
 | |
|     {
 | |
|         // Live: use the random generator and remember the value.
 | |
|         if (m_is_live) {
 | |
|             u64 value = random_generator();
 | |
|             m_run.append(value);
 | |
|             return value;
 | |
|         }
 | |
| 
 | |
|         // Not live! let's get another prerecorded value.
 | |
|         auto next = m_run.next();
 | |
|         if (next.has_value()) {
 | |
|             return min(next.value(), max);
 | |
|         }
 | |
| 
 | |
|         // Signal a failure. The value returned doesn't matter at this point but
 | |
|         // we need to return something.
 | |
|         set_current_test_result(TestResult::Overrun);
 | |
|         return 0;
 | |
|     }
 | |
| 
 | |
| private:
 | |
|     explicit RandomnessSource(RandomRun const& run, bool is_live)
 | |
|         : m_run(run)
 | |
|         , m_is_live(is_live)
 | |
|     {
 | |
|     }
 | |
|     RandomRun m_run;
 | |
|     bool m_is_live;
 | |
| };
